Good News! Germany Removes Transit Visa Rule For Indians; Here’s What This Means

Indian nationals no longer require an airport transit visa when travelling to another country with a layover at an airport in Germany.

This is amazing news for Indian travellers. Indians will no longer need an airport transit visa when travelling to another country through airports in Germany. The new rule, announced by the German Embassy in New Delhi, came into effect on June 3. Here’s how it will help make journeys smoother for travellers.

Indian Travellers Don’t Need A Transit Visa At Airports In Germany 

Before getting into the details, let us briefly explain what a transit visa is. It is a short-term travel permit that allows you to briefly enter or pass through a country while travelling to your final destination. It used to be necessary at German airports for Indians, but not anymore. According to The Times of India, Indian nationals no longer require an airport transit visa when travelling to another country with a layover at an airport in Germany.

The removal of the airport transit visa requirement for Indian citizens came into effect on June 3. The announcement aims to ease travel procedures for Indian nationals transiting through Germany. It also reflects efforts by both nations to strengthen their bilateral ties.

Travellers Cannot Leave The Airport 

Travellers should keep in mind that the removal of the transit visa requirement does not mean they can enter Germany. They are only allowed to remain in the airport’s transit zone and cannot leave the airport. According to The Economic Times, the measure was first announced during Chancellor Friedrich Merz’s visit to India in January this year.

However, Germany is not the first Schengen country to announce this rule. France had also removed the airport transit visa requirement for Indian travellers. It became the first Schengen country to fully eliminate the transit visa requirement for Indians.
